$15,000 In Counterfeit Goods Found During Traffic Stop

A traffic stop in Wayne County netted authorities $15,000 in counterfeit clothes and two arrests.
The sheriff's Aggressive Criminal Enforcement Team stopped a vehicle Monday evening near Stoney Creek Baptist Church.
In the vehicle deputies found counterfeit footwear, blue jeans, shirts, sweatshirts and jackets.
Charged with criminal use of counterfeit trademark are Michael Collie of LaGrange and Curtis Jones of Goldsboro.
Deputies says the Secretary of State's Trademark & Counterfeiting Division is assisting Wayne County in the investigation.
